Baiyin is a prefecture-level city in northeastern Gansu province, People's Republic of China. Established in the 1950s as a base for mining non-ferrous metals, its mines are becoming exhausted in recent decades, requiring the city to reinvent its economy.[1] Located around from Gansu's capital Lanzhou, it is part of the Lanzhou-Baiyin Economic Belt.
